Subtract 20/36 from 14/12
1st number: 1 2/12, 2nd number: 20/36
14/12 - 20/36 is 11/18.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 12 and 36 is 36
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 36 - For the 1st fraction, since 12 × 3 = 36,
14/12 = 14 × 3/12 × 3 = 42/36 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 36 × 1 = 36,
20/36 = 20 × 1/36 × 1 = 20/36 - Subtract the two like fractions:
42/36 - 20/36 = 42 - 20/36 = 22/36 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 11/18
